Abstract
Lifelong learning and continuing education are the need of social development and the improvement required by society. This paper gives them a new relationship that the two is dialectical unity, namely they are different, related and mutually developed. Continuing education should be carried out throughout people's whole life via various kinds of ways to promote lifelong learning. This paper states from three aspects that are the connotation of lifelong learning and continuing education, the dialectical relationship between the two, and unity of development.
